The people of Tyrone gathered to celebrate Labor Day with a picnic.

Local organizations including the Boy Scouts, the Rotary and Kiwanis Clubs all sold food. Chicken, ribs and hot dogs were cooked on the grill at Reservoir Park. There was also entertainment and games for the kids.

“Personally, I love events like this,” Tyrone Mayor Bill Latchford said. “Anything that gets the community together is a fabulous event in my book.

“To celebrate today is important because everyone works so hard, they deserve another day off. I love seeing the people running around and having a good time.”

The mayor is happy to see so many groups using the park.
